After applying the cumulative patches on our Dev and QA systems we received this error: AHD04617: Unknown webengine operation when editing Knowledge Documents (clicking on the "User View" button produces the error). Has anyone else experienced this problem? I have a ticket in with CA about it but haven't received a response in weeks. We're on R11.2 separate web/db servers SQL 2005 Win Svr 2003 Thanks in adv for any suggestions or help. Tai |

Update from CA:
Test fix details : - ********************* PRODUCT: Unicenter Service Desk Web Server RELEASE: 11.2 PROB #: 322 FN: T5EJ023 FT: D34 DATE: 20 Nov 2007 STARTRAK PRODUCT NAME: USRDWS (Star Problem Product) PROBLEM SYMPTOM: NT -PROBLEM AFTER APPLY TEST FIX T13B629 ---------------------------------------------------- After applying test fix T13B629, when you open a Knowledge Document, in edit mode and then click on user View, a page is displayed that says that the operation has failed.

Hello Taileen,
I have attached a test fix for this issue with the issue detail. The test fix name is T5EK022. Please download the test fix from the SupportConnect Web Site, apply and test the same. Please let me know if you face any issues or concerns when applying the test fix.
Regards, Praveen.
Thank you, CA Technical Support ------------------------------------------
Hello everyone,
I applied this patch and it worked fine.
thanks, Tai
